Problemi i rizici korištenja EOL verzija PHP-a

Problemi i rizici korištenja EOL verzija PHP-a

Problemi i rizici korištenja EOL verzija PHP-a

Što se tiče razvoja web aplikacija, korištenje PHP-a kao programskog jezika postalo je standard. Međutim, mnogi se korisnici još uvijek oslanjaju na EOL (End of Life) verzije PHP-a, što može imati ozbiljne posljedice.

Prvo, sigurnosni rizici jedan su od najvećih problema povezanih s korištenjem EOL verzija. Kada PHP verzija dosegne EOL, prestaje primati sigurnosna ažuriranja i ispravke grešaka. Ovdje su EOL datumi za različite PHP verzije:

PHP 5.6: EOL u prosincu 2018
PHP 7.0: EOL u prosincu 2018
PHP 7.1: EOL u prosincu 2019
PHP 7.2: EOL u studenom 2021
PHP 7.3: EOL u prosincu 2021
PHP 7.4: EOL u studenom 2022
PHP 8.0: EOL u studenom 2023. (planirano)
PHP 8.1: EOL u studenom 2024. (planirano)
PHP 8.2: EOL u studenom 2025. (planirano)

To znači da su aplikacije koje koriste ove verzije ranjive na napade. Zlonamjerni akteri mogu lako iskoristiti poznate sigurnosne propuste, što može dovesti do gubitka podataka ili neovlaštenog pristupa sustavima.

Drugo, kompatibilnost s novim tehnologijama može biti izazovna. Popularni PHP CMS-ovi poput WordPressa i Joomle često se oslanjaju na specifične PHP verzije. Ako vaša aplikacija koristi staru verziju PHP-a, mogu se pojaviti problemi s kompatibilnošću prilikom ažuriranja ovih CMS-ova ili instaliranja novih dodataka i tema. Osim toga, nove verzije ovih platformi obično zahtijevaju novije PHP verzije.

Nadalje, korištenje EOL verzija može otežati dobivanje tehničke podrške. Mnogi programeri i zajednice, uključujući forume kao što su Stack Overflow i phpBB , više ne pružaju pomoć za starije verzije, ostavljajući korisnike bez potrebnih resursa za rješavanje problema. Taj nedostatak podrške može dovesti do duljeg vremena rješavanja problema, što može negativno utjecati na poslovanje.

Na kraju, važno je napomenuti da korištenje EOL verzija također može rezultirati lošim radom aplikacije. Nova izdanja PHP-a donose poboljšanja u brzini i učinkovitosti, što znači da će aplikacije koje koriste starije verzije raditi sporije, potencijalno frustrirajući korisnike i umanjujući njihovo iskustvo.

Zbog svih ovih rizika korisnici moraju hitno izvršiti nadogradnju na najmanje PHP verziju 8.2. Nova verzija ne nudi samo sigurnosna poboljšanja, već i nove značajke koje mogu poboljšati performanse i razvoj aplikacija.

Zaključno, korištenje EOL verzija PHP-a može donijeti brojne rizike, uključujući sigurnosne ranjivosti, probleme s kompatibilnošću, nedostatak podrške i loše performanse aplikacija. Razmislite o nadogradnji na podržane verzije kako biste osigurali sigurnost i učinkovitost svojih sustava.

HUB Hosting – Hosting & Cloud rješenja
Pokreće Digital Synergy Ltd

hub hosting

Cloud Solutions

Secure, cost-effective, and fully managed cloud solutions
Cloud solutions tailored for your business